Recipe Variations
These bacon-wrapped asparagus bundles are savory and slightly sweet. Other variations include using different flavors of bacon, such as maple, applewood smoked, or peppered. You can also try some of these other flavor enhancers.
- Spicy – For a spicy kick, add red pepper flakes or jalapenos.
- Salty and Nutty – If you prefer to highlight salty or nutty flavors, sprinkle with parmesan cheese.
- Tangy – To balance the sweetness with a little tang, create a balsamic glaze by drizzling the asparagus with some balsamic vinegar before baking.

Alternative Cooking Methods
You don’t have to cook bacon-wrapped asparagus in the oven. If you don’t have an oven (or don’t want to heat up your kitchen), you can make bacon-wrapped asparagus using an air fryer or grill.
Follow the step-by-step directions (below) to prepare your fresh asparagus. If using an air fryer, make sure you don’t overcrowd your trays. If using a grill, heat the grill to medium-high and cook for 3-5 minutes before turning the asparagus over and cooking for another 3-5 minutes.
Cooking Method | Cook Time | Temperature | Flavor |
Air Fryer | 10-12 minutes | 400°F | Crispy bacon, tender asparagus |
Grill | 3-5 minutes per side | Medium-high heat | Smoky, crispy bacon, tender asparagus |

How to Make Bacon-Wrapped Asparagus
Supplies Needed
- Rimmed Baking Sheet – Prepare a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and place a cooling rack on top so that the bacon can drain onto the parchment paper as it cooks.
- Bowl – Choose a small to medium-sized bowl.
- Knife – A sharp paring knife works well.
- Pastry Brush – If you don’t have a pastry brush, you can crumple a coffee filter, dip it into the butter, and use it like one.

Ingredients Needed
- Brown Sugar – For a Keto-friendly version, brown sugar can be omitted.
- Butter – Avocado, coconut, or olive oil can be substituted.
- Fresh Asparagus – Choose spears that are tight and green. Spears that are open or wilted are not fresh.
- Bacon – About 16-20 slices of bacon. Learn how easy it is to dry-cure meat at home.
- Garlic Powder – Learn how to grow garlic here.
- Black Pepper – To taste






Step-by-Step Directions
- Preheat the oven to 400°F, prepare a baking sheet with parchment paper and a cooling rack, and set aside.
- Combine brown sugar and butter into a bowl and melt together. Stir to combine, set aside.
- Chop the bottoms off your asparagus stalks.
- Combine 3 or 4 asparagus stalks and wrap one slice of bacon around, starting at the bottom.
- Place on a prepared baking sheet rack. Repeat the process till all the stalks are wrapped in bacon.
- Brush the butter and brown sugar mixture over the bacon-wrapped asparagus.
- Sprinkle the asparagus and bacon with the garlic powder.
- Place the wrapped asparagus in the oven and bake for 20-30 minutes until the bacon is crispy.
- Remove from the oven and enjoy it warm.

FAQ’s
What temperature do I cook bacon-wrapped asparagus in the oven?
To cook bacon-wrapped asparagus in the oven, set the temperature to 400 degrees Fahrenheit. This heat makes the bacon crispy and the asparagus tender.
Why shouldn’t you snap the ends off asparagus?
Handling asparagus gently is key to avoid damaging it. Snapping the ends off can make the spears tough. Instead, trim the ends with a knife or kitchen shears to remove any tough parts.
What goes with bacon wrapped asparagus?
Bacon-wrapped asparagus goes well with many sides. Try it with roasted vegetables, quinoa, or a simple green salad. The asparagus’s earthy taste complements various flavors and textures.

Bacon-Wrapped Asparagus Recipe
Equipment
- Rimmed Baking Sheet prepared with parchment paper and a wire cooling rack
- Bowl
- Pastry Brush
Ingredients
- 1/4 cup Brown Sugar
- 2 Tablespoons Butter
- 1 pound Fresh Asparagus
- 1 pound Bacon
- 1/4 teaspoon Garlic Powder
- Pepper to taste
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 400°F, prepare a baking sheet with parchment paper and a cooling rack, and set aside.
- Combine brown sugar and butter into a bowl and melt together. Stir to combine, set aside.
- Chop the bottoms off your asparagus stalks.
- Combine 3 or 4 asparagus stalks and wrap one slice of bacon around, starting at the bottom.
- Place on a prepared baking sheet rack. Repeat the process till all the stalks are wrapped in bacon.
- Brush the butter and brown sugar mixture over the bacon-wrapped asparagus.
- Sprinkle the asparagus and bacon with the garlic powder.
- Place the wrapped asparagus in the oven and bake for 20 -30 minutes until the bacon is crispy.
- Remove from the oven and enjoy it warm.
